In what has become a yearly tradition, Vladimir Putin took questions from Russians in an hours-long, wide-ranging call-in show that touched on the conflict in Ukraine, the murder of Kremlin critic Boris Nemtsov, Russia's sale of missiles to Iran and the price of milk.
Putin flatly denied that there are Russian soldiers fighting covertly in Ukraine, despite numerous eyewitness reports to the contrary.
"There are no Russia troops fighting in Ukraine," he said.
